Hi all, new to the forums here, I just recently purchased my first toyota, its a 1980 with a 20R, decent little rig, it has what appears to be the original Aisan Carb.. the truck is running a bit rough, she will only accept idle at around 1500RPM's .. any lower and it likes to die at stop signs and such, if i idle her down to around 800rpm where id imagine it should be, she shakes, thumps, and fluxes up and down between 800-1300rpms on her own, ive tryed adjusting the fuel/air, but it doesnt seem to effect anything, the fuel is in the middle of the dot on the eyeglass, ive pumped enough carb cleaner to start a fire, changed cap/rotor, plugs, wires, threw some lucas carb cleaner in the tank etc etc.. all i could figure was the carb is crap, so i purchased the redline weber 32/36 toyota 20R kit, was curious if its just a simple installation, or is there any surprises i might run into? And any suggestions or opinions on my idle issue would be great, thanks!

I have the Redline 32/36 kit on my 20R, the bracket for the throttle cable didn't bolt on anywhere, I think they sent me one for a 22R, I didnt like the way they wanted me to run the throttle cable anyway so I made my own setup.
The carb is sweet, seems to run on any angle so its good for wheeling. When its cold out it ices up but you just have to let the motor sit for a minute and restart it and its fine until the motor is cold again, If I had an EGR it would be fine but my truck never came with one from the factory.
My idle is set at 850, the intake on the Weber makes it really loud inside the truck but, no complaints!

if the truck dies when you use the brake your timing is late or there is a vaccuum leak. the old aisin carb could be leaking like mad. If you spray carb cleaner on the housing and the idle changes then you found your problem.
also make sure your timing is set good and follow the webre base tuning proceedure. If you have any problems getting it dialed hit me up I am in your back yard.
